Dream for College Project: Inspiring first generation to college 5th graders On May 20th, Reach Potential Movement will partner with Castro Elementary school in Mountain View, CA to inspire 50 mostly Latino fifth grade students with an up close college experience at Stanford University.  Click here if you would like to sponsor a student with [...]

On a beautiful Sunday afternoon (4/25), Castro Elementary, Open Door Church (Mountain View) and Reach Potential Movement celebrated Día del Niño (Day of the Child), a holiday celebrated around the world, especially in Latin countries and a newer holiday:  Día del Libro (World Book Day). “Bookshelf in Every Home” Project Launch! As we have listened to educators in local low income schools, the need we have heard most dramatically is literacy… especially early literacy efforts to empower parents before their children fall one to two grades behind in reading.  RPM’s response is our “Bookshelf in Every Home” Project, in which [...]
